If you are staying at a hotel use the computer in the business center (usually free for guests) and go to joann's web page. You can print out the coupons. Lately the web page has had better coupons than the app. You can print out Hobby Lobby, Michaels and AC Moore's coupons the same way. Joann takes them as long as they are for something that is sold in both stores. If you do get a plan to use your phone in the states, get the app. You can use the coupons from the app, the web site and the news paper at the same time for different items. Enjoy your visit.
